电脑桌面
添加小米粒文库到电脑桌面
安装后可以在桌面快捷访问

SSIS学习概要VIP免费

SSIS学习概要_第1页
1/28
SSIS学习概要_第2页
2/28
SSIS学习概要_第3页
3/28
SSIS学习概要•SSIS基础概念•SSIS开发环境配置•数据流任务设计•控制流任务设计•SSIS包管理与部署•SSIS性能优化与最佳实践contents目录01SSIS基础概念SSIS(SQLServerIntegrationServices)是Microsoft提供的一个用于数据集成的平台,它允许用户从各种数据源中提取、转换和加载数据。SSIS是ETL(Extract,Transform,Load)工具的一种,用于实现数据的清洗、整合和迁移等操作,支持数据仓库的构建和数据集成解决方案的开发。SSIS定义及作用数据流(DataFlow)在SSIS中,数据流是指数据从一个源移动到目标的过程。数据流由源、转换和目标等组件构成,用户可以通过配置这些组件来实现数据的提取、转换和加载等操作。控制流(ControlFlow)控制流定义了包中任务的执行顺序和依赖关系。在SSIS中,任务可以是数据流任务,也可以是执行SQL语句、发送邮件等其他类型的任务。控制流通过任务之间的连接线和约束条件来控制任务的执行顺序。数据流与控制流组件(Components)在SSIS中,组件是构成数据流的基本单元,包括源组件、转换组件和目标组件等。源组件用于从数据源中提取数据,转换组件用于对数据进行清洗和转换,目标组件用于将数据加载到目标数据源中。任务(Tasks)任务是构成控制流的基本单元,用于执行特定的操作。SSIS提供了多种内置任务,如数据流任务、执行SQL任务、发送邮件任务等。用户还可以根据需要自定义任务。组件与任务02SSIS开发环境配置下载SQLServer安装包选择要安装的功能配置实例完成安装选择安装类型运行安装包从Microsoft官方网站下载适用于您的操作系统的SQLServer安装包。双击下载的安装包,按照安装向导的指示进行安装。在安装过程中,选择“新SQLServer独立安装或添加功能到现有安装”。在功能选择页中,勾选“IntegrationServices”选项。根据您的需求配置SQLServer实例,包括实例名称、端口号等。按照安装向导的指示完成安装过程。安装SQLServerIntegrationServices打开SQLServerDataTools(SSDT):在安装SQLServer时,会同时安装SQLServerDataTools(SSDT)。打开VisualStudio并选择“SQLServerDataTools”选项。创建新项目:在SSDT中,选择“文件”->“新建”->“项目”,然后选择“IntegrationServices项目”。配置项目属性:在项目属性中,可以配置项目的名称、位置、目标服务器等。添加数据源和目标:在项目中,可以添加数据源和目标,例如OLEDB连接、FlatFile连接等。配置开发环境选择数据源类型根据您的数据源类型选择相应的连接管理器,例如OLEDB连接管理器、FlatFile连接管理器等。添加连接管理器在SSIS设计器中,右键单击“连接管理器”区域,选择“新建连接”来添加新的连接管理器。配置连接属性在连接管理器的属性页中,配置连接的属性,例如服务器名称、数据库名称、认证方式等。添加目标连接同样地,您可以为目标添加连接管理器并配置相应的属性。测试连接配置完成后,可以单击“测试连接”按钮来测试连接是否成功。连接到数据源和目标03数据流任务设计数据源类型支持多种数据源类型,如SQLServer、Oracle、Excel等。连接管理器创建和管理连接,以便从数据源读取数据或将数据写入目标。目标设置指定数据写入的目标,如SQLServer表、平面文件等。数据源与目标设置数据转换在数据流中对数据进行转换,如数据类型转换、字符串操作等。数据清洗对数据进行清洗,如去除重复行、空值处理、异常值处理等。表达式与脚本组件使用表达式或脚本组件进行复杂的数据转换和清洗操作。数据转换与清洗定义错误输出,以便在数据流任务发生错误时捕获并处理错误行。错误处理配置日志记录,以便跟踪数据流任务的执行情况和错误信息。日志记录使用调试工具进行故障排除,如设置断点、查看变量值等。调试与故障排除错误处理与日志记录04控制流任务设计容器与任务类型在SSIS中,容器是用来组织和管理包中的控制流元素。它们可以包含其他容器或任务,以及连接这些元素的优先约束。主要的容器类型包括Foreach循环容器用于重复执行控制流中的一个或多个任务,直到满足指定的条件。序列容器用于将多个任务组合成一个单独的可管理单元,这些任务按照定义的顺序执行。容器...

1、当您付费下载文档后,您只拥有了使用权限,并不意味着购买了版权,文档只能用于自身使用,不得用于其他商业用途(如 [转卖]进行直接盈利或[编辑后售卖]进行间接盈利)。
2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。
3、如文档内容存在违规,或者侵犯商业秘密、侵犯著作权等,请点击“违规举报”。

碎片内容

SSIS学习概要

确认删除?
VIP
微信客服
  • 扫码咨询
会员Q群
  • 会员专属群点击这里加入QQ群
客服邮箱
回到顶部